FLAC程序使用手册.._第1页
FLAC程序使用手册.._第2页
已阅读5页,还剩12页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、第1页 共13页FLAC输入命令FLAC 的输入和一般的数值模拟的程序不一样 , 它可以用交互的方式从键盘输入各个命令 , 也 可以写成命令文件 , 类似于批处理 , 由文件来驱动。FLAC 命令大小写一样。所有的命令可以附带若干个关键词和有关的数值。在下面的命令解释 中 , 只有大写的字母起作用 , 小写的字母写不写、写多少个都没有崐关系。 i,j,m 和 n 开始的变量 要求整型数 , 否则要求实型数。 ?实型数的小数点可崐以忽略 , 但是整型数不能带小数点。数值间可 以用空格隔开 , 空格的数目不限 ,? 也可以用下面的分隔符隔开 :( ), / =表示可选的参数 , 输入时括号不用输入

2、 ;.表示可以有任意个参数。由 * 号开始到行末为注释 , FLAC 在执行时不理会。下面的 FLAC 命令按字母排列。Apply 关键词 = 数值 可以有下面的关键词 :Pressure 压力XForceX-方向的力YForceY-方向的力ATtach该命令可以将一条线上的结点和另一条线上的结点互相接合在一起 ,用以形成复杂的网格形状。Call文件名写成的命令文件可以用 Call 命令来调用 , 命令文件的最后一行必须是RETURN, 以返回到交互方式。命令文件中不能有 CALL 命令本身。Config 关键词FLAC 用以解平面应变问题 , ? 但经过配置命令也可以用于解平面应力问题或轴对

3、称问题。 需要时应在形成网格之前发。关键词有 :P_STR平面应力问题AX轴对称问题第2页 共13页该命令同 STEP, 为执行 n 个时步的循环运算。FixX 用此命令可以使 内结点的 x- 或 y- 方向的速度保持不变。 的格式可以是 I = i1,i2, J = j1,j2; i和 j ? 何者先输入没有关系。如果要求位移固定, 则必须将速度初始化为零(开始时速度的缺省值为零)。FIX 和 INI XV, YV ? 可以联合使用以提供一个刚性移动的边 界条件。如果有 MARK 的关键词 , 则只有在此范围内被标记的结点将被固定。FRee X YX Y该命令与 FIX 命令相反 , 用于放

4、松对结点的约束。GEn x1,y1 x2,y2 x3,y3 x4,y4 用于在全域或局域中产生网格。 (x1,y1) 的点放在左下侧 , (x2,y2)、(x3,y3)和 (x4,y4) 为顺时针排列。如果点和前一个 GEn 命令中的相同则用SAME 来代替。如果网格不是均匀排列,则用关键词 RATIO,?在 I 和 J 方向的比例系数分别为ri 和 rj.GEn Circle xc,yc radArc xc,yc xb,yb thetaLine x1,y1 x2,y2该命令产生园、弧或直线。ARC弧的圆心为 (xc,yc), 起始点为 (xb,yb), 逆时针的角为 theta 度CIRCL

5、E园的中心为 (xc,yc),半径为 radLINE直线的两端为 (x1,y1) 和 (x2,y2).用 ARC 等关键词所形成的边界系被标记(参见命令 MARK 和 UNMARK 过,标记结点所围住的区域在以后用命令INITAL, MODEL 和 PROPERTY 寸可以用关键词 REGION 来说明。Gen ADJust用此命令来微调网格 , 使之离散平滑。该命令可以连续使用以增进平滑效果的。Grid icol jrow此命令用以产生数目为 icol 列和 jrow 行的网格。对于 640k 内存的 FLAC 版本, 如CYC n第3页 共13页用摩尔 -库仑的本构模型约可分两千个单元。第

6、4页 共13页His 每隔 NSTEP 时步 , 记录一下关键词所示项目在 i1 和 ji ?结点或单元的数值。 缺省值为 10. 用户应记住所要求 His (历史)?的顺序 , 因以后在打印或绘图时要用。历史值在 停止运行时删除 , 因此如果要保留的话 , 要用到命令 HIS WRITE N ( 见下面 )。可以用的关键词有 :Ang单元 i,j内的最小主应力和X- 轴所形成的夹角PP单元 i,j内的孔隙压力SIG1单元 i,j的最大主应力SIG2单元 i,j的最小主应力SXX单元 i,j的 xx- 应力SYY单元 i,j的 yy- 应力SXY单元 i,j的 xy- 应力X结点 i,j的 x

7、- 坐标Y结点 i,j的 y- 坐标XDis结点 i,j的 x- 位移YDis结点 i,j的 y- 位移Unbal最大不平衡力XVel结点 i,j的 x- 速度YVel结点 i,j的 y- 速度XXA单元 i,j三角形 a 的 xx-应力XYA单元 i,j三角形 a 的 xy-应力YYA单元 i,j三角形 a 的 yy-应力XXB单元 i,j三角形 b 的 xx-应力XYB单元 i,j三角形 b 的 xy-应力YYB单元 i,j三角形 b 的 yy-应力XXC单元 i,j三角形 c 的 xx-应力XYC单元 i,j三角形 c 的 xy-应力Help帮助命令 , 可在屏幕上显示命令表。NSTEP

8、 的FLAC第5页 共13页YYC单元 i,j三角形 c 的 yy-应力XXD单元 i,j三角形 d 的 xx-应力XYD单元 i,j三角形 d 的 xy-应力第6页 共13页关键词关键词可以是 :Dump nhis将第 nhis 的历史写屏 ;Write nhis将第 nhis 的历史写在文件 FLAC.HIS 上, ? 该文件可在 FLAC 结束后打印出来。连续执行 HIS WRITE 命令可将结果顺序写在 FLAC.HIS 上, ? 但是首次执行此命令会将 以前盘上所存的同名文件冲掉 ;Reset 所有的历史都清除掉。 Initial 关键词 = 值 某些结点值可以给初值 :PP空隙压力

9、X x-坐标Y y-坐标SXX xx-应力SYY yy-应力SXY xy-应力XDisp x-位移YDisp y-位移XVel X-速度YVel y-速度还有几个可选用的关键词以协助实现 INITIAL 命令 :Mark 只有标记的结点值将被初始化Region i j为标记结点所围住的区域将被初始化。 i,j 为标记区域中的任一个单元Var xv, yv 在一定范围内的参数的变差值 , xv 和 yv 为 x- 方向和 y-? 方向的变差值。范围可以有形式 I=i1,j1 J=j1,j2,其中 i 和 j 的先后次序无关。INTerface n 关键词 n 关键词 = 值INTERFACE 为

10、交界面命令。网格的一部分可以和网格的另一部分通过交界面而相互作用。界面的性质由其刚度 , 粘结力和摩擦力来表征。用于本命令的关键词有 :Aside i1,j1 YYD单元 i,j 三角形 d 的 yy- 应力His第7页 共13页Bdide i1,j1 Cohesion粘结力值Friction摩擦力值GluedKN法向刚度值KS切向刚度值TBond抗拉强度Unglued胶结命令 GLUE 将使交界面的上下两部分胶结在一起 , 使之不能滑动和分离 , 命令UNGLUE 则为命令 GLUE 之逆。MArk 在给定范围内的结点将被标记。计算的进行与结点的标记与否无关 , 但标记的结点可以 限定一个区

11、域作为命令 INITIAL, PROP 和 MODEL 的作用域。命令 GEN 将自动对结点进行标记。 的形式可以是I=?i1, i2, J=j1,j2, i 和 j 的顺序无关。Model 关键词 该命令对于给定的区域或范围赋予有关的本构模型。关键词有 :ANisotropic横观各向同性弹性模型Elastic弹性 , 各同性本构模型Mohr-Coulomb摩尔 - 库伦塑性模型Mull零模型 , 用于开挖掉的单元SS应变软化Ubiquitous彻体节理模型NEW 该命令可以不用退出 FLAC 重新开始一个新问题。Plot 关键词 开关 . 用缺省值。可以在一行上连写几个关键词以在一个图上画

12、出几个变量。在绘图前先要用MODEL 命令赋予网格以一定的本构模型。?关键词及其意义为:BEam 画出结构单元的几何形状Boundary画出网格的内外边界Cable画出锚束的几何形状位移矢量Disp第8页 共13页E_p塑性应变的轮廓线 ( 只限于应变软化材料Grid画出画出纪录在第 nhis 个历史上的变量值PP孔隙压力的等值线RF以矢量形式画出的固定结点的反力STAte画出单元中心当前的屈服状态STress主应力矢量SXXxx-应力的等值线 ( 全应力 )SYYyy-应力的等值线 ( 全应力 )SXYxy-应力的等值线Velocity以箭头画出的速度矢量WAter水位线XDispx-位移的

13、等值线YDispy-位移的等值线XVelx-速度YVely-速度所谓开关其本身也是关键词 , 用于设置图形的的某些特征 , 有 : color 如红为 Red, 绿为 GREen, 黄为 Yellow 等。Interval = c将等值线的间距置为 c.? ? 在 ?PLOT ?命令前发扫描线命令SCLIN 可以画出等值线的值。Max = v在画矢量时, 置箭头的最大长度为 v.Noh不画标题Zero不画零值线如果要放大或缩小图形,可以在 PLOT 命令前用 WINDOW 命令来设置窗口的大小。Print 关键词 . 和绘图命令 PLOT 一样, 结点变量的值只有在给定的材料模型和性质后才可以

14、打印出来。关键词有 :第9页 共13页Apply打印出所施加力或压力的大小和范围Fix打印出固定 x 或 y 的结点Limits对 SOLVE 命令的限制值第10页 共13页主要的网格关键词Bulk体积模量COhesion粘结力Den质量密度Dilation剪胀角E_p全塑性应变 ( 应变软化模型 )Friction摩擦系数SHear剪切模量X X-坐标Y Y-坐标PP孔隙压力JFric节理摩擦力JCoh节理粘结力JAngle节理角度NUYx y-x泊松比NUZx z-x泊松比SIG1最大主应力SIG2最小主应力SXX XX-应力SYY YY-应力SXY XY-应力Theta最小主应力与 x-

15、 轴的夹角XDis X-位移YDis Y-位移XMod X-模量YMod Y-模量XVel X-速度MEm占用的内存STruct打印出结构单元上有关结点的力 , 力矩和位移Interface打印出交界面的数据 , 包括结点力和单位法向矢量MArk打印出标记结点Var xv yvPROp 关键词 = 值 本命令为 MODEL 命令赋予 材料的性质。下面的关键词对Region i,j所有为标记结点所连续包围的区域将赋予该性质。的任一单元ASXXXX-应力 ( 三角形 A)BSXXXX-应力 ( 三角形 B)CSXXXX-应力 ( 三角形 C)DSXXXX-应力 ( 三角形 D)ASYYYY-应力

16、( 三角形 A)BSYYYY-应力 ( 三角形 B)CSYYYY-应力 ( 三角形 C)DSYYYY-应力 ( 三角形 D)ASXYXY-应力 ( 三角形 A)BSXYXY-应力 ( 三角形 B)CSXYXY-应力 ( 三角形 C)DSXYXY-应力 ( 三角形 D)State塑性状态0弹性1正在屈服中2曾经屈服 , 现为弹性3已超过单轴抗张力4屈服并超过单轴抗张力5已经超过抗张力6彻体节理正在屈服7彻体节理过去屈服过 , 现为弹性状态Tables打印所存贮的表格XReaction X-反力YReaction Y-反力YVel Y-速度PROPERTY 命令加以补充i,j 单元可为标记区域中V

17、ar xv yv第8页 共13页第13页 共13页性质可以有变差 , xv 和 yv 分别为 x- 方向和 y-? 方向的变差值可为 I=i1,i2, J=j1,j2, i 后。各种模型所需输入的性质为 弹性(1)剪切模量(2)体积模量(3)密度摩尔 - 库伦(1)剪切模量(2)体积模量(3)密度(4)摩擦角(5)粘结力(6)剪胀角 ( 任选 )横观各向同性(1)剪切模量(2) x-模量(3) y-模量(4)密度(5) NUYx(6) NUYz彻体节理(1)剪切模量(2)体积模量(3)密度(4)粘结力 ( 整体材料 )(5)摩擦力 ( 整体材料 )(6)节理粘结力(7)节理摩擦力(8)节理角和

18、 j 孰者在前无妨但 必需在输入行的最第14页 共13页(9) 整体材料的剪胀角 ( 任选 )应变-硬化 /软化(1)剪切模量(2)体积模量(3)密度(4)初始摩擦角 ( 任选 )(5)初始粘结力 ( 任选 )(6)摩擦角和塑性应变的关系表的表号(7)粘结力和塑性应变的关系表的表号(8)剪胀角和塑性应变的关系表的表号如果表号给 0, 则取关键词 COHESION, DILATION 或 FRICTION 所给出的值。Quit 该命令同 STOP,FLAC 终止运行。REstore 文件名把以前用 SAVE 命令所存的文件读入内存恢复现场。RETurn 该命令应是输入数据文件中的最后一个命令。S

19、Ave 文件名将内存中问题的现场存入文件中 , 如果已经有同名的文件 , 则该文件将被复盖。SClin n x1,y1 x2,y2该命令在屏幕上作一个扫描线 , 以切割等值线 , 交点以 A 到 Z 的字母来表示。在一张图上最多可以有 5 条扫描线。扫描线的参数为 :n =扫描线的编号 ( 必需为 1,2,3,4 或 5)x1,y1 =扫描线的起点坐标x2,y2 =扫描线的终点坐标SEt 该命令设置整体条件 , 其关键词有 :Aspect a调整屏幕的高宽比 , 以使输出不变形Col nn 为打印输出的最大列数。用户必需在运行 FLAC 前设置好打印机的列数。第15页 共13页Force f设

20、置 SOLVE 命令时的不平衡力的限值。Gravity g 重力加速度 g 及其与负 y- 轴的夹角Large 大变形 ( 坐标更新 )Log ON在当前盘上打开名为 FLAC.LOG 的文件 , 以纪录 FLAC 的运行进程。如果 FLAC.LOG文件已经存在 , 则将被复盖。OFF 关闭 FLAC.LOG 文件。如果在稍后再 SET LOGON, ?则屏幕显示将继续纪录在 FLAC.LOG 文件上。Small 小变形 ( 坐标不更新 )STep nSOLVE命令进行计算循环的限制数目。Time tSOLVE命令进行计算的限制时间的分钟数。SOLve 用本命令进行计算循环 , 关键词为 :S

21、tep时步数目Time运行时间 (分钟数 )Force不平衡力缺省值为 :S = 500 时步T = 5分钟F = 100最长的时限为 1440 分钟(24 小时) , 如果要求运算超过一天 , 则可以用几个 SOLVE 的 命令。FLAC在运行中如要中止 , 可以按退出键 Esc 退出循环 , 将控制转给用户 , 进行交互操作 STEp n执行 n 个时步的循环运算。STop FLAC 终止运行。 STRuct 关键词 . . .EGA设置 640 x350 的 EGA 图形模式第16页 共13页命令用于定义结构单元的几何形状,性质等条件。STRUCT 命令要求说明结构单元的类型和形状以及它

22、与 FLAC 网格的连接情况。定义结构单元的关键词有 :(1)结构类型关键词梁一个梁单元系在关键词 BEAM 后用梁的几何形状和性质的关键词及其值来表征。锚束一个锚束单元系在关键词 CABLE ?后以其几何形状和性质的关键词及其值来表征。(2)结构单元的几何形状及其结点联结Begin关键词关键词 BEGIN 表征梁或锚束的起始点End关键词 END 表征梁或锚束的终了点结构单元的端点可以在 BEGIN 和 END 关键词后直接用下面三个之一的关键词来表征 : Grid i,j结构单元的起点或终点为结点 i,jNode nFLAC ?将自动按照构件单元输入的顺序为结构单元的结点编号,此处 n 为所编的第 n 号结点。x,y 直接给端点以 x 和 y 坐标。(3)结构单元的性质类型关键词Prop n结构单元的类型要赋予性质数 n,用 struct prop=n

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论